OECD warn UK on deficit

British Chancellor Gordon Brown today received a fresh warning that he faces the prospect of raising taxes or cutting public spending if he is to bring the British government’s finances under control.

The Paris-based Organisation for Economic Cooperation and Development said that unless tax revenues picked up, the rising government deficit may force the Mr Brown to act.
